Moon Neighborhood Overview

Overview

The Moon neighborhood is a well-established residential area in the southwest part of Gillette, Wyoming. It is situated near the intersection of South Douglas Highway and Warlow Drive, offering convenient access to major city routes. This neighborhood provides a quiet, family-oriented atmosphere within the Energy Capital of the Nation.

Housing

Housing in Moon primarily consists of single-family homes built from the 1970s through the 1990s, featuring ranch-style and split-level designs. Lots are generally spacious, and the streets are laid out in a traditional grid pattern. The area represents some of Gillette's more affordable and established housing stock.

Getting Around

The neighborhood is bordered by South Douglas Highway (Wyoming Highway 59), a major arterial that connects directly to downtown Gillette and Interstate 90. Internal streets are low-traffic, making it easy for residents to navigate locally. Most errands and commutes require a car, as is common in this region.

Parks & Recreation

The neighborhood is served by the nearby Bicentennial Park, which offers sports fields, playgrounds, and picnic areas. For outdoor enthusiasts, the nearby Gillette Fishing Lake and the George Amos Memorial Golf Course are easily accessible. The Campbell County Recreation Center is also a major draw for indoor swimming, fitness, and events.
